“What is Operation Management?
Operations management” concerns the planning and organizing of the administrative, financial and operational processes of a company to better direct and utilize internal resources.”
The optimization of Operations is required for any organization in any industry. And when it comes to the healthcare industry where the people’s lives are at stake, it becomes a necessity rather than just a need. Effective healthcare clinical operations management goes beyond just improving productivity, it strategies and facilitates the efficient provision and delivery of health care services to patients and communities to ultimately save and improve lives.
After such optimization, the most improved facilities have been able to achieve and sustain 5-10% improvements in their operating costs: 1-3% from productivity gains resulting from greater operational efficiency; another 3-4% through clinical standardization; and an additional 1-3% through the process and decision-support changes related to supply choice and utilization. In addition, greater efficiency and liberated capacity enabled the facilities to increase both volume and stakeholder satisfaction.
Why does health care operations management matter?
In health care practices and facilities, operations management is responsible for facility oversight, staff functionality, and delivery of the best care possible.
"What are health care operations?
Health care operations include the administrative, financial, and legal activities of a hospital, specialty practice, ancillary care provider, or remote health service center. Health care professionals need to get a handle on operations because, at minimum, they enable running the business.”
Some examples of health care operations include patient case management, coordination of care within and without practice, financial management, and medical practice human resources.
Benefit from operations management
Health care operations take a variety of forms. As mentioned above, health care operations span the spectrum of administration to care delivery. Below are example areas that benefit from operations management.
Effective Clinical Care Management The health care industry is a service industry, so it makes sense when organizations make a concerted effort to standardize protocol to improve performance. Improving clinical care management can result in reduced readmissions and improved patient-provider relationships.
Help Reduce Risks with Risk Management Medical practices improve when providers mitigate and optimally manage risk. Examples of risk in a health care setting range from patient or staff injuries to ballooning costs of expensive services. Hospitals can leverage predictive analytics technology to cut down on extravagant or extraneous costs while striving for improved patient satisfaction.
Effective Financial management Health care operations management deals with reducing and optimizing costs in a medical organization. Medical practices and hospitals have many issues controlling costs. Cost issues can come from unnecessary treatments or medication prescriptions, treating uninsured patients, or budget reductions that directly impact the technology, equipment, and salary resources of medical staff.
Achieving “Operational excellence”
“Operational excellence” is a term that comes up when you talk about effective and efficient health care operations."
Clinical operational excellence generally starts at the top (for instance, with demands from stakeholders), but depends on the mindset and behaviors of staff at every organizational level. When practices, hospitals, and clinics achieve operational excellence, any change in process can result in increased operational efficiency, reduction of clinical variability, and maintained or even improved care quality. That means facilities and medical professionals can keep up with industry and technological trends, ensuring modernized practices that can provide the best care for patients, regardless of diagnosis, medical needs, or the availability of clinical services.
